Bagaimana saya bisa mengaktifkan ekstensi mysqli di php 8?

Bagaimana cara mengaktifkan MySQLi? . Kemudian, saya harus menjelaskan bagaimana kita dapat mengaktifkan MySQLi di server cpanel dan Bagaimana kita dapat memeriksa apakah MySQLi sudah diaktifkan atau belum di server

Apa itu MySQLi?

Sederhananya itu adalah ekstensi MySQL untuk bahasa pemrograman PHP. Ekstensi MySQLi (MySQL Improved) adalah driver database relasional yang digunakan dalam bahasa pemrograman PHP untuk menyediakan antarmuka dengan database MySQL

Pengembang bahasa pemrograman PHP merekomendasikan penggunaan MySQLi ketika berhadapan dengan server MySQL versi 4. 1. 3 dan yang lebih baru (memanfaatkan fungsionalitas baru). Ekstensi MySQLi memiliki banyak manfaat, beberapa di antaranya tercantum di bawah ini

  • Antarmuka berorientasi objek
  • Dukungan untuk pernyataan yang disiapkan
  • Dukungan untuk beberapa pernyataan
  • Dukungan untuk transaksi
  • Dukungan debug yang ditingkatkan
  • Dukungan server tertanam
  • Fungsi yang Kuat

Bagaimana cara memeriksa ekstensi MySQLi diaktifkan atau tidak di server?

Anda dapat memeriksa ekstensi MySQLi dari baris perintah itu sendiri dengan menjalankan perintah berikut

# php -m | grep mysql

bagaimana cara mengaktifkan ekstensi MySQLi di web-server dengan cPanel?

EasyApache 3

Kami cukup mengaktifkan ekstensi MySQLi dengan membangun kembali server web dengan skrip Easyapache. Ini sangat sederhana, cukup jalankan skrip yang ditempel di bawah dari baris perintah sebagai pengguna root, dan pilih MySQLi dari daftar ekstensi. Lihat gambar terlampir untuk lebih jelasnya

# /scripts/easyapache 
Bagaimana saya bisa mengaktifkan ekstensi mysqli di php 8?
Cara mengaktifkan MySQLi

EasyApache 4

Anda dapat langsung mengaktifkannya dari panel WHM. Silakan lakukan langkah-langkah berikut untuk mengaktifkannya

Langkah 1. Masuk ke panel WHM

Langkah 2. Buka Beranda » Software » EasyApache 4

Langkah 3. Klik "Sesuaikan"

Bagaimana saya bisa mengaktifkan ekstensi mysqli di php 8?
Cara mengaktifkan MySQLi

Langkah 4. Buka Ekstensi PHP

Bagaimana saya bisa mengaktifkan ekstensi mysqli di php 8?
Cara mengaktifkan MySQLi

Mengakses PhpMyAdmin tanpa login cPanel?

Artikel ini akan membantu Anda mengakses database pengguna cPanel tanpa mengakses akun cPanel

Pertimbangkan skenarionya, Anda memiliki akun cPanel dan Anda ingin membagikan detail database (DB) dengan salah satu pengembang situs kami dan sebenarnya Anda tidak ingin membagikan kredensial cPanel

Di EasyApache 4, ekstensi mysqli disediakan oleh paket mysqlnd. Untuk mengilustrasikannya, berikut adalah daftar file yang disediakan oleh paket ea-php55-php-mysqlnd

Ekstensi MySQLi dirancang untuk bekerja dengan MySQL versi 4. 1. 13 atau lebih baru, Jadi harus download MySQL. Semua unduhan untuk MySQL terletak di Unduhan MySQL. Pilih nomor versi terbaru untuk MySQL Community Server yang Anda inginkan dan, setepat mungkin, platform yang Anda inginkan

Instalasi MySQL di Linux/UNIX

Cara yang disarankan untuk menginstal MySQL pada sistem Linux adalah melalui RPM. MySQL AB menyediakan RPM berikut untuk diunduh di situs webnya −

  • MySQL − Server database MySQL, yang mengelola database dan tabel, mengontrol akses pengguna, dan memproses kueri SQL

  • MySQL-client − Program klien MySQL, yang memungkinkan untuk terhubung dan berinteraksi dengan server

  • MySQL-devel − Perpustakaan dan file header yang berguna saat mengkompilasi program lain yang menggunakan MySQL

  • MySQL-shared − Pustaka bersama untuk klien MySQL

  • MySQL-bench − Tolok ukur dan alat pengujian kinerja untuk server database MySQL

RPM MySQL yang tercantum di sini semuanya dibangun pada sistem Linux SuSE, tetapi biasanya akan bekerja pada varian Linux lainnya tanpa kesulitan

Sekarang, ikuti langkah-langkah berikut untuk melanjutkan instalasi –

  • Login ke sistem menggunakan pengguna root

  • Beralih ke direktori yang berisi RPM −

  • Instal server database MySQL dengan menjalankan perintah berikut. Ingatlah untuk mengganti nama file yang dicetak miring dengan nama file RPM Anda

[root@host]# rpm -i MySQL-5.0.9-0.i386.rpm

    Perintah di atas menangani penginstalan server MySQL, membuat pengguna MySQL, membuat konfigurasi yang diperlukan, dan memulai server MySQL secara otomatis

    Anda dapat menemukan semua binari terkait MySQL di /usr/bin dan /usr/sbin. Semua tabel dan database akan dibuat di direktori /var/lib/mysql

  • Ini adalah langkah opsional tetapi disarankan untuk menginstal sisa RPM dengan cara yang sama −

[root@host]# rpm -i MySQL-client-5.0.9-0.i386.rpm
[root@host]# rpm -i MySQL-devel-5.0.9-0.i386.rpm
[root@host]# rpm -i MySQL-shared-5.0.9-0.i386.rpm
[root@host]# rpm -i MySQL-bench-5.0.9-0.i386.rpm

Menginstal MySQL di Windows

Penginstalan default pada versi Windows apa pun sekarang jauh lebih mudah daripada sebelumnya, karena MySQL kini dikemas dengan rapi dengan penginstal. Cukup unduh paket penginstal, unzip di mana saja, dan jalankan setup. exe

Pengaturan penginstal bawaan. exe akan memandu Anda melalui proses sepele dan secara default akan menginstal semuanya di bawah C. \mysql

Uji server dengan menyalakannya dari command prompt pertama kali. Pergi ke lokasi server mysqld yang mungkin C. \mysql\bin, dan ketik -

mysqld.exe --console
_

CATATAN - Jika Anda menggunakan NT, maka Anda harus menggunakan mysqld-nt. exe bukannya mysqld. exe

Jika semuanya berjalan lancar, Anda akan melihat beberapa pesan tentang startup dan InnoDB. Jika tidak, Anda mungkin memiliki masalah izin. Pastikan direktori yang menyimpan data Anda dapat diakses oleh pengguna mana pun (mungkin mysql) yang menjalankan proses database

MySQL tidak akan menambahkan dirinya sendiri ke menu mulai, dan juga tidak ada cara GUI yang bagus untuk menghentikan server. Oleh karena itu, jika Anda cenderung memulai server dengan mengklik dua kali eksekusi mysqld, Anda harus ingat untuk menghentikan proses secara manual menggunakan mysqladmin, Daftar Tugas, Pengelola Tugas, atau cara khusus Windows lainnya

Memverifikasi Instalasi MySQL

Setelah MySQL berhasil diinstal, tabel dasar telah diinisialisasi, dan server telah dimulai, Anda dapat memverifikasi bahwa semuanya berfungsi sebagaimana mestinya melalui beberapa tes sederhana

Gunakan Utilitas mysqladmin untuk Mendapatkan Status Server

Gunakan biner mysqladmin untuk memeriksa versi server. Biner ini akan tersedia di /usr/bin di linux dan di C. \mysql\bin di windows

[root@host]# mysqladmin --version

Ini akan menghasilkan hasil berikut di Linux. Ini dapat bervariasi tergantung pada instalasi Anda −

mysqladmin  Ver 8.23 Distrib 5.0.9-0, for redhat-linux-gnu on i386
_

Jika Anda tidak mendapatkan pesan seperti itu, mungkin ada beberapa masalah dalam instalasi Anda dan Anda memerlukan bantuan untuk memperbaikinya

Jalankan perintah SQL sederhana menggunakan MySQL Client

Anda dapat terhubung ke server MySQL Anda dengan menggunakan klien MySQL menggunakan perintah mysql. Saat ini, Anda tidak perlu memberikan kata sandi apa pun karena secara default akan dikosongkan

Jadi gunakan saja perintah berikut

[root@host]# mysql

Itu harus dihargai dengan prompt mysql>. Sekarang, Anda terhubung ke server MySQL dan Anda dapat menjalankan semua perintah SQL di prompt mysql> sebagai berikut −

mysql> SHOW DATABASES;
+----------+
| Database |
+----------+
| mysql    |
| test     |
+----------+
2 rows in set (0.13 sec)
_

Langkah-langkah Pasca Instalasi

MySQL dikirimkan dengan kata sandi kosong untuk pengguna root MySQL. Segera setelah Anda berhasil menginstal database dan klien, Anda perlu mengatur kata sandi root sebagai berikut –

[root@host]# mysqladmin -u root password "new_password";
_

Sekarang untuk membuat koneksi ke server MySQL Anda, Anda harus menggunakan perintah berikut –

[root@host]# mysql -u root -p
Enter password:*******

Pengguna UNIX juga ingin meletakkan direktori MySQL Anda di PATH Anda, jadi Anda tidak perlu mengetikkan path lengkap setiap kali Anda ingin menggunakan klien baris perintah. Untuk bash, itu akan menjadi seperti -

export PATH = $PATH:/usr/bin:/usr/sbin

Menjalankan MySQL saat boot

Jika Anda ingin menjalankan server MySQL saat boot, pastikan Anda telah mengikuti entri di /etc/rc. berkas lokal

Bagaimana cara mengaktifkan Mysqli di PHP 8?

Buka php.ini Anda. file ini ( file konfigurasi php ) di dalam direktori PHP Anda ( atau direktori windows ). Cari mysqli dan aktifkan dll dengan menghapus ; . Anda mungkin harus mem-boot ulang sistem Anda. . You may have to re-boot your system.

Apakah PHP 8 mendukung MySQLi?

Sejak PHP 8. 2 dan yang lebih baru, kompilasi ekstensi mysqli dengan libmysql tidak lagi didukung . Perhatikan bahwa masih mungkin untuk mengkompilasi ekstensi pdo_mysql dengan libmysql , dukungan untuk libmysql mungkin akan dihentikan di ekstensi pdo_mysql di masa mendatang.

Bagaimana cara menginstal ekstensi Mysqli di PHP?

Mengunduh MySQL. Ekstensi MySQLi dirancang untuk bekerja dengan MySQL versi 4. 1. .
Instalasi MySQL di Linux/UNIX. .
Menginstal MySQL di Windows. .
Memverifikasi Instalasi MySQL. .
Gunakan Utilitas mysqladmin untuk Mendapatkan Status Server. .
Jalankan perintah SQL sederhana menggunakan MySQL Client. .
Langkah-langkah Pasca Instalasi. .
Menjalankan MySQL saat boot

Bagaimana cara memeriksa apakah Mysqli diaktifkan di PHP?

Periksa apakah MySQLi sudah diinstal . php -m. grep mysqli .